This course is designed to equip candidates with the knowledge, skills, and attitudes necessary to undertake advanced audit and assurance engagements in compliance with regulatory frameworks and International Standards on Auditing (ISAs). Through this course, candidates will develop a deep understanding of advanced auditing techniques and principles, preparing them to handle complex audit assignments and ensure adherence to professional and ethical standards.

Learning Outcomes

Upon successful completion of this course, candidates will be able to:

  • Recognise the Regulatory, Professional, and Ethical Issues Relevant to Those Carrying Out an Assurance Engagement: Identify and address the key regulatory, professional, and ethical considerations in audit and assurance engagements.
  • Assess and Recommend Appropriate Quality Control Policies and Procedures in Practice Management: Evaluate and suggest effective quality control measures to enhance audit practice management.
  • Evaluate Findings and Results of Work Performed and Draft Suitable Audit Reports on Assignments: Analyze audit findings and prepare comprehensive audit reports based on the results of the audit work performed.
  • Draft Different Types of Audit Opinions Based on Audit Evidence Gathered During an Audit: Formulate and present various audit opinions that reflect the audit evidence and findings accurately.
  • Draft Engagement Letters for Audit and Non-Audit Services That Fall Under International Standards on Auditing and Ensure Compliance with the Relevant Legal Regulations: Prepare engagement letters that meet the requirements of ISAs and comply with applicable legal standards.
  • Incorporate Emerging Developments in the Conduct of an Audit: Adapt to and integrate new trends and advancements in the field of auditing to enhance audit quality and effectiveness.
